Rec of the day

I skipped a lot of days of recs recently, but to make up for it I have a really long one today, and it's a page-turner:
At Your Service by [livejournal.com profile] faithwood (Harry Potter)
96,000 words; Harry/Draco and ensemble; NC-17; mystery/action/romance
Summary: Hogwarts students are in danger; Harry is determined to save them all. There's only one thing he knows for certain: Draco Malfoy is somehow involved.

The story is set after the end of book 7; Harry and his yearmates are briefly back at Hogwarts to finish their final exams, but they soon get sidetracked by inexplicable goings-on that threaten the students. I recommend this fic also for those who otherwise don't ship Harry/Draco. The mystery is complex, extremely well plotted and has a satisfying conclusion. And as a mainly gen reader I really liked the way the Harry/Draco part of the story developed and meshed with the rest of the plot.
